“Combines the gritty toughmindedness of the best coaches with the gentle-but-insistent inspiration of the most effective spiritual advisers” (Fast Company).

This groundbreaking New York Times bestseller has helped hundreds of thousands of people at work and at home balance stress and recovery and sustain high performance despite crushing workloads and 24/7 demands on their time.

We live in digital time. Our pace is rushed, rapid-fire, and relentless. Facing crushing workloads, we try to cram as much as possible into every day. We're wired up, but we're melting down. Time management is no longer a viable solution. As bestselling authors Jim Loehr and Tony Schwartz demonstrate in this groundbreaking book, managing energy, not time, is the key to enduring high performance as well as to health, happiness, and life balance. The Power of Full Engagement is a highly practical, scientifically based approach to managing your energy more skillfully both on and off the job by laying out the key training principles and provides a powerful, step-by-step program that will help you to:

* Mobilize four key sources of energy
* Balance energy expenditure with intermittent energy renewal
* Expand capacity in the same systematic way that elite athletes do
* Create highly specific, positive energy management rituals to make lasting changes

Above all, this book provides a life-changing road map to becoming more fully engaged on and off the job, meaning physically energized, emotionally connected, mentally focused, and spiritually aligned.© 2003 Jim Loehr and Tony Schwartz; (P)2003 Simon and Schuster, Inc.

I read atomic habits a couple of years ago and both books fundamentally tell the same story. However I like the angle the authors are taking here, as it is more targeted to “start with your personal why”, whereas atomic habits is a more simplistic performance oriented workbook modeling how to develop routines. Both books serve a very important purpose and help you navigate the challenge of the everyday life in the knowledge economy better. I love the term “corporate athlete” as I had this image in my mind for years already since I draw a lot of comparisons and success recipes from NBA athletes.
